Shelter Field Officer

                                                                                 Shelter Field Officer Deadline for applications: 15th of August 2013                                     Première Urgence - Aide Médicale Internationale (PU-AMI) is a non-profit, non-political and non religious humanitarian NGO. Its objective is to bring about a global response to the basic needs of populations suffering from acute humanitarian crisis and to allow them to recover their autonomy and dignity.   Today, PU-AMI is intervening in 22 countries in Africa, the Near East, Caucasus, Asia and the Caribbean to cover the needs of populations affected by conflict, natural disasters or economic crises.   PU-AMI has been active in Lebanon by implementing emergency and recovery projects in Water, Sanitation and Hygiene, Shelter Rehabilitation, Food Security  and in Livelihood Recovery sectors.   OVERALL MISSION   General objective   The Shelter field officer implements and monitors the shelter rehabilitation, sanitation facilities upgrading, and kits distribution activities on the field level, under coordination of the management staff. He/she also will conduct surveys, fill relevant documents, evaluate, assess, and report on vulnerable conditions.   Responsabilities and tasks     -      Participate in the identification of potential project beneficiaries through the needs assessment in the targeted area according to the project criteria. -      Implement a detailed (PRE/POST) assessment of each selected beneficiary need for winterization and sanitation facility upgrading. -      Daily visit to units under rehabilitation to assess quality and quantity of work done. -      Conduct surveys using specific formats -      Ensure timely distribution of the materials to the beneficiaries, with continues monitoring of proper use. -      Be in regular and direct contact with beneficiaries -      Ensure field level monitoring of the quality of all works implemented within the scope of the project. -      Contributes to work related reports -      Report immediately on achievements or difficulties faced to the direct supervisor -      Participate in the implementation of the project impact survey. -      Participate in identification and referrals of special hardship cases during the life cycle of the project. -      Accomplish any other tasks assigned by supervisor   The tasks and responsabilities of the Shelter Field Officer mentionned above are not thorough and may be subject to evolve depending on the needs PU-AMI may have.   Supervision   Ø Under the direct supervision of: Shelter Supervisors Indirect supervision of: / Under the overall supervision of: Shelter Project Manager
